Soak up the sun and stay cool in the chilled water of Lake Erie at one of the beaches at Presque Isle State Park. That's right. You've got your choice of more than a handful of beaches to spend the day. Join other beach goers, for example, at Pettinato Beach. The guarded beach boasts a concession stand, picnic areas in a wooded area, and a bathhouse.
Presque Isle State Park is located at 301 Peninsula Dr., Erie, PA 16505.
Road trips and summer just go hand-in-hand. So, hit the road for Conneaut Lake, an hour and a half from downtown Pittsburgh. The town, popular for Conneaut Lake Park, promises a beautiful sandy beach with all the activities you'd expect to find near the ocean: Boating, sunbathing, volleyball, and strolling along a picturesque boardwalk. Of course, you might also want to save some time to visit Conneaut Lake Park while you're in town.
Conneaut Lake is located in Conneaut, PA 16316.

Laurel Hill State Park in Somerset features a pristine 1,200-foot sandy beach surrounding a 63-acre lake. Stroll down the pier before jumping into the cool lake water, which is only five feet at its deepest. Other popular activities at the beach, which also hosts a concession stand, include boating and kayaking.
Laurel Hill State Park is located at 1454 Laurel Hill Park Rd., Somerset, PA 15501.
Stay cool all summer long at Moraine State Park, just a 40-minute drive from downtown Pittsburgh. The sprawling park boasts the massive 3,225-acre Lake Arthur and two fabulous beaches. Both Pleasant Valley Beach on the south shore and Lakeview Beach on the north shore promise plenty of warm sand, a concession stand, and showers. Pleasant Valley Beach also offers a playground and a sand volleyball court.
Moraine State Park is located at 225 Pleasant Valley Rd., Portersville, PA 16051.
Raccoon Creek State Park just might be the closest beach, at a state park at least, to downtown Pittsburgh. Hit the road for the 30-mile trek from downtown Pittsburgh. Throw your favorite beach towel down on a slice of the 500-foot sandy beach or opt for a more private spot on the grass. The sandy beach leads to the cool water of Raccoon Lake. Bring your own picnic lunch, or buy food and drinks from the beach's concession stand.
Raccoon Creek State Park is located at 3000 PA-18, Hookstown, PA 15050.
